Hua Xue is a scholar working on Plant Science, Molecular Biology and Cancer Research. According to data from OpenAlex, Hua Xue has authored 40 papers receiving a total of 1.3k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 19 papers in Plant Science, 13 papers in Molecular Biology and 5 papers in Cancer Research. Recurrent topics in Hua Xue's work include Seed Germination and Physiology (14 papers), Plant Stress Responses and Tolerance (11 papers) and Allelopathy and phytotoxic interactions (6 papers). Hua Xue is often cited by papers focused on Seed Germination and Physiology (14 papers), Plant Stress Responses and Tolerance (11 papers) and Allelopathy and phytotoxic interactions (6 papers). Hua Xue collaborates with scholars based in China, United Kingdom and United States. Hua Xue's co-authors include Maode Lai, Bingjian Lü, Xiaofeng Wang, Hugh W. Pritchard, Yumei Du, Zhihao Wu, Bing Zhou, WU Yong-sheng, Liqiang Su and Ye‐Guang Chen and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Biological Chemistry, Blood and PLoS ONE.
